Meaning & Definition

Understanding what does PPU mean in text begins with recognizing that there isn’t a single universal definition. Like many internet abbreviations, the meaning changes depending on the conversation and platform.
In everyday texting, PPU most commonly stands for:
- Pending Pick Up
- Please Pick Up
- Price Per Unit
- Power Processing Unit (technical)
- Other specialized meanings depending on the industry
The surrounding conversation almost always reveals the intended meaning.
Pending Pick Up
This is by far the most common interpretation in online buying and selling.
When a seller writes:
“The item is PPU.”
they usually mean:
“Someone has already agreed to buy it and is expected to pick it up soon.”
The item hasn’t officially been sold yet, but another buyer currently has priority.
Example:
Buyer: Is the chair still available?
Seller: It’s PPU at the moment. I’ll let you know if the buyer doesn’t come.
This usage is extremely common on Facebook Marketplace and local selling groups.
Please Pick Up
Among friends or family, PPU may simply mean Please Pick Up, referring to answering a phone call.
Example:
“I’m calling you now. PPU.”
This is a quick way to ask someone to answer immediately.
Price Per Unit
In business, finance, retail, and inventory management, PPU frequently refers to Price Per Unit.
For example:
- Apples: $2.50 PPU
- Bricks: $0.80 PPU
- Bottled water: $1.20 PPU
Businesses use this abbreviation when comparing costs or calculating inventory expenses.

Meaning of PPU in Physics, Medical, and Aircraft Terminology
Beyond texting and social media, PPU also appears in technical and professional environments. The exact meaning depends on the industry.
PPU Meaning in Physics
In physics and engineering discussions, PPU may refer to a Power Processing Unit.
A Power Processing Unit regulates and distributes electrical power between different components in a system. It is commonly associated with advanced electrical equipment, satellites, and space propulsion systems.
Its responsibilities often include:
- Managing electrical power
- Controlling voltage levels
- Improving system efficiency
- Protecting sensitive equipment
This meaning is entirely unrelated to texting or social media.
